I don't think this was ever a bug in Gnote but GNOME Shell seems to make icons disappear for some apps occasionally.  It seems to happen to me now for xchat consistently.   Step to reproduce

1) Start xchat
2) click on the icon on the message tray
3) App and icon becomes invisible but app is still running

I just want to confirm that I have the same issue. It seems to be when I restart gnome-shell or when it hangs every so often and I have to kill it.

I found a possible solution to this though posted in the xchat bug reports:

http://sourceforge.net/tracker/index.php?func=detail&aid=2905743&group_id=239&atid=100239

See the comment at that link which says "Adding GDK_STRUCTURE_MASK to the gdk_window_set_events call in src/fe-gtk/fe-gtk.c seems to fix it."
